MEMBER SCHOOLS ARE REMINDED THAT ALL STUDENT ACTIVITIES IN CONNECTICUT OF A NON-ATHLETIC NATURE WHERE MORE THAN TWO SCHOOL DISTRICTS ARE INVOLVED REQUIRE THE APPROVAL OF THE CONNECTICUT STUDENT ACTIVITIES CONFERENCE.
